About CVP.com
Written by the company

For more than 30 years, CVP has been one of the leading Broadcast and Professional video solutions providers in the United Kingdom and Europe, with a comprehensive UK and EU sales and support infrastructure.
The company prides itself on maintaining close relationships with key manufacturers such as ARRI, Sony, RED and Canon, and uses its unrivalled experience to listen to customers, understand their needs and deliver the right solution with first class service.
CVP Group offers creative consultation, sales advice, technical service provision and training.

Don’t expect a refund for a faulty…
Don’t expect a refund for a faulty product… CVP considers it your problem. Their main priority is to sell.
I had always been very satisfied with CVP until I ran into a serious problem.
In January 2026, I purchased an Aputure C80 with accessories. Within just 2.5 months, the unit started malfunctioning — randomly changing colour, brightness, and modes during use. I provided CVP with a video as proof of the fault.
I contacted CVP to request a refund for the faulty product, but my request was refused. The only option I was offered was a repair, which I declined — I paid for a brand-new product, not a defective one.
Under the Consumer Rights Act 2015, goods must be of satisfactory quality, fit for purpose, and as described. If a product develops a fault within the first six months, it is presumed to have been faulty at the time of purchase. Customers are entitled to reject faulty goods and receive a full refund.
CVP’s refusal to provide a refund directly contradicts these statutory consumer rights. I have already initiated a dispute through my bank and will provide updates as the case progresses.
A very disappointing experience.
